A basic assumption underlying the definition of groupthink is that more reasonable decisions are made by groups than by individuals, group members desire peace and harmony within the group.
A groupthink is a type of deliberation where members do not air their opinions in a bid not to cause dissension, In a groupthink, the desire for harmony and cohesion most times overrides objective thinking and solution to a problem.
